If using the md5 hashing algorithm, what is the length to which each message is padded?

a. 32 bits
b. 64 bits
c. 128 bits
d. 512 bits

If using the MD5 hashing algorithm, the length to which each message is padded 512 bits.

Answer: (d.) 512 bits.

MD5 stands for Message Digest 5. It is a hashing algorithm that is case sensitive. It is a cryptographic hash values.
